Some service providers advise press piers while others rely on helical piers. Acculevel has been repairing foundations given that 1996 as well as we have mounted both kinds of piers.

Just how are Helical as well as Push Piers the Same? Both helical and also push piers are intended to be long-term structure fixing remedies.

Piers can be set up inside or outside a structure, and can typically be mounted within a couple of days, depending upon the quantity called for. Exactly how are Helical and Push Piers Different? Press piers are hefty tubes that are hydraulically driven through a foundation bracket as well as into the earth until they reach rejection below a home's structure.

This shape permits them to be screwed right into the ground as opposed to pushed. They're hydraulically turned right into the ground without applying any type of force to your foundation, as well as a stress gauge system determines when the called for depth is fulfilled. This is an image of a helical pier. When the pier is in area, a steel brace is mounted, linking the pier to your foundation firmly.

Helical piers are a better selection for structures that aren't as hefty. This consists of: most domestic houses with 2 tales or less, houses without put concrete footings as well as poured concrete walls, older structures, or as a preventative procedure in brand-new building and construction projects. They count on the torque of being turned right into more stable dirt instead of the weight of the building.

One of the most common size of helixes for home structure repair is find more information an 8" as well as 10" configuration. Extensions are linked to the lead area to continue setting up to higher depths. These likewise been available in a selection of sizes, yet the most typical dimension made use of is 7'. Therapeutic braces attach to your home's structure and the helical stack.

Now, here are precisely how the problem pieces meshed. The very first point that will occur on a helical pier foundation repair service task is the excavation of each pier area. These openings are generally 3x3 feet and spaced out every 6 feet. Periodically, a little bit of is required to reach your ground.

This offers sufficient area to comfortably fit a therapeutic brace to your home's footing after it's been manicured down with a jackhammer. We constantly reduced away excess concrete to make sure a gapless link to your house's ground. As soon as the pier openings have been dug deep into and no treasure discovered, the staff starts the helical pier instillation process.

The helical is mounted to a needed lots which is monitored and determined by the installation torque. This torque achievement can happen anywhere between 7 to 150 feet depending on the dirt conditions.

The denser the soils, the better the torque called for to spin the helical right into the ground. As soon as we know the load and we understand the helical material that will certainly be used we can compute the amount of torque that will be needed to accomplish the wanted tons.
